YY59 HVX is a 2009 BMW 530 in Black with a 2,979c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2009 BMW 530 models, the average MOT pass rate is 81.3% with a typical mileage of 94,161 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 530 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 30,757 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YY59 HVX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 530 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 17 years old, this BMW 530 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
